Q: What is NAPMA?
NAPMA, the National Association of Professional Martial Artists, is a martial arts marketing, continuing education, networking and support association for martial arts schools and clubs worldwide. It is the largest such association in the world, with members in more than 20 countries.
NAPMA is proud of its diverse membership—from new instructors and newly opened schools to well-established school owners; part-time instructors with a few classes a week as well as school owners with multiple locations and hundreds of students; and instructors of many arts, languages and cultures. Professional martial artists of any style, background or affiliation are welcomed to join NAPMA.
NAPMA’s professional staff serves its members through a number of membership opportunities and a complement of member benefits and support programs.
NAPMA’s mission is to increase dramatically the number of people participating in quality martial arts programs worldwide.
NAPMA’s goal is to help its members create the futures they envision for themselves, their schools and their families.
NAPMA’s purpose is to lead the industry into a future of greater recognition by the public of the martial arts’ role in developing children into leaders and positive adult role models; to help members improve staff training and develop school ownership and career opportunities; and promote local schools as community support and self-defense learning centers.

Q: How is NAPMA organized?
A: NAPMA is a U.S. corporation, operating from offices in Clearwater, Florida, where a full-time, professional staff serves its members. Led by President Rob Colasanti, NAPMA is organized into five services teams. (Click here to view the Key Staff page.)
Member Services: A staff of member service professionals, managed by Melissa Gouley, helps members with orders, address changes, billing and shipping issues and general assistance. The member services staff also talks with martial arts instructors and school owners throughout the industry to introduce them to the benefits of a NAPMA membership and its products. Qualified members of staff also serve as consultants, helping members with enrollment, retention, tuition, staff development, marketing and operations challenges.
Operation Services: As operations manager, Melissa Gouley supervises an administrative team that provide equally important services, including administrative support, data management, human resources and financial/bookkeeping. The NAPMA fulfillment center is also a part of Operation Services. That staff assembles, processes and ships all membership packages and product orders to all members, domestic and international, and the bi-monthly NAPMA Squared Package. The fulfillment center crew also maintains a comprehensive inventory of past NAPMA and NAPMA Squared Packages, the NAPMA product line and a video training library with hundreds of segments. The staff processes and ships new member start-up kits and product orders every day.
Audio/Video Production Services: NAPMA maintains a professionally equipped video production/editing facility in its offices, managed by Mark Graden. He is able to shoot broadcast- quality video on location for original productions as well as edit a variety of audio and video programs distributed to members. Every month, Mark works with Rob Colasanti to select, edit and prepare the Sounds of Success CD and the NAPMA Innovations DVD, two of NAPMA’s most popular educational programs in the NAPMA Professional Package. Mark also edits and prepares audio and video segments for the NAPMA Squared Package. Additionally, Mark confers with martial arts instructors who want to develop video training series or curriculum programs, ventures in which NAPMA may become a production, marketing and fulfillment partner.
Creative Services: Bob Sillick coordinates a staff of graphic designers and Web specialists whose primary responsibilities is the monthly NAPMA Professional Package, Martial Arts Professional magazine, NAPMA eNews and content management of the NAPMA Web site. The staff also produces the bi-monthly NAPMA Squared Package as well as many NAPMA marketing projects and NAPMA products and packaging. Bob works closely with Rob Colasanti to plan and create the content for the enormous amount of educational and marketing support materials NAPMA produces and distributes every month.
Consulting Services: A special team, integral to outstanding member support, is the NAPMA School Support Network (NSSN). The network consists of NAPMA-member volunteers from across the U.S., who are available to consult with other members on any issue or challenge that may be an obstacle to growth and success.
